i can't get over the dichotomy that is russell crowe. much like daniel day-lewis, he bugs the living crap out of me and is yet unreasonably good at his job. (in contrast to daniel day-lewis, of course, russell crowe manages to do this without actually trying to convince himself that he's someone or something he's not. he recognizes, as far as i've been able to tell, that his job is to pretend -- unlike all these Method actors who drive me so bananas.) this was a good role for him; less of the Great Big Hero like in gladiator or a beautiful mind, and more of the By The Way, He's The Crux Of The Film like in the insider (and, i could argue if i wanted to, the quick and the dead). i like his subtler work, god help me.
